Godly Wisdom

Godly wisdom—internal reasoning, pictures, and words that come from God’s Word and/or the Holy Spirit that is sealed in the believer.

Ephesians 1:13 NAB – “In him you also, who have heard the word of truth, the gospel of your salvation, and have believed in him, were sealed with the promised Holy Spirit.”

The Word of God’s wisdom must reside in your human spirit and also in your brain in order for you to live the abundant life God intends. The brain is involved in every single thing you do—how you think, how you feel, how you act, and how you interact with others. It is the instrument God gave you so that you can be in touch, to make contact with the world. God is amazing! The brain is a wonder of His creation and wisdom.

Your brain is made of approximately 100 billion nerve cells called neurons, which have 500 trillion connections. Neurons have the amazing ability to gather and transmit electrochemical messages. These messages give you thoughts, which give you feelings that move you toward or away.

The purpose of God’s wisdom (God’s think) is to give us life and give us life abundantly. Jesus is our wisdom!

1 Corinthians 2:16 RSV – “. . . we have the mind of Christ.”

James 3:17 NASB – “But the wisdom from above is first pure, then peaceable, gentle, reasonable, full of mercy and good fruits, unwavering, without hypocrisy.”

Galatians 5:22-23 NASB – “But the fruit of Spirit is love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ness, and self-control . . . .”

To be “fruit” means that it is ready to be consumed by the believer. To consume the think of God means it is a living part of us. Transformation is possible because we are designed by God with the ability to have authority over what is in our brain.

1 Corinthians 2:6-7 NKJV – “We speak wisdom among those who are mature, yet not the wisdom of this age [world] . . . we speak the wisdom of God.”

Decide what you want in your brain, practice doing the truth, and you will be able to stand against the lust of the eyes, the lust of the flesh, and the boastful pride of life.

Training Your Brain Exercise – Ears to Hear and Eyes to See

Today notice the words and the visuals that pop into your mind. If it helps, write them down in your journal. When you develop ears to hear and eyes to see, you can be objective over these thoughts (words and visuals). Once you develop the ability to be objective, you can take thoughts and lead them to truth or destroy them.

It is your brain; decide what you will allow and what you will not allow to reside in you. Pray right now and ask God to give you ears to hear and eyes to see. Make your commitment to God and He will give you wisdom that comes from above.
